Software company IFS said in a report that industrial workers lose 41% of their time to manual, repetitive tasks creating a capacity gap across organisations. New research from The Futurum Group report shows companies are closing that gap with a sharp shift toward agentic, AI-powered digital workers — AI agents that autonomously monitor, decide, and execute operational tasks, escalating to humans only when judgement is required.
The capacity gap – the widening distance between the work industrial organisations need to do and the actual capacity of their teams – is becoming increasingly costly for businesses to ignore. A workforce change is also already underway, and hitting industrial organisations hardest: experienced engineers and operators are retiring across factories, utilities, and supply chains.
Industrial companies want to address the capacity gap with new technologies but hesitate to put their full trust in automation. The research underscores the need for human-in-the-loop models of AI deployment, where digital workers handle high-volume, well-defined tasks while people make judgement calls.

IFS customers across sectors are already running purpose-built digital workers in production. Several customers, including Kitron Group and KLN Family Brands, are using digital workers to reclaim dozens of hours a week on core procurement and order-to-pay workflows, with several pushing toward a fully automated processing, with no manual interception.
Manufacturer Kitron Group is rolling out purchase-to-order digital workers across all 13 of its sites by the end of 2026, built directly into the software the business already uses. This meant that the guardrails and rules the business had already set up were followed, and the existing approvals process stayed intact. During this rollout, a digital worker surfaced a decade-old part-number error that a manual process had missed for years, showing that digital workers can find and fix data problems as they run, instead of requiring a data cleanup project before deployment.
